Singapore Chinese Cultural Centre launches Bak Chang Hunt mini-game and videos for Singaporeans to learn more about Duanwu Festival
Dragon Boat Festival, Duanwu Festival, Dumpling Festival – beyond these familiar variations, did you know that the festival was also known as Health Festival? Duanwu was traditionally regarded as an evil month because many people tended to fall sick during the summer solstice, which was the hottest period of the year.
